logo

Output 3bd89357aff76c478608755c6e7db4907722279f74d3b31a610380c71853a293:1

value
30624642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f4872479f31ad59b8f85f88d5e11a4432b217e OP_EQUALVERIFY OP_CHECKSIG
address
1DDHocNRiGEseFYFCPYT5YMtQ8oZidfTwq
transaction
3bd89357aff76c478608755c6e7db4907722279f74d3b31a610380c71853a293